Deep Foundation Installation in Fredericksburg, VA
Deep foundation installation services involve the process of constructing stable support structures beneath a building or other large structure to ensure safety and durability. This service is essential for projects such as new home constructions, additions, or renovations that require additional stability, especially in areas with challenging soil conditions. Property owners typically seek deep foundation solutions to prevent settlement issues, support heavy loads, or prepare sites for construction where shallow foundations may not be suitable.
Before requesting deep foundation installation, property owners usually want to understand the specific types of foundations available, such as drilled shafts, piles, or piers, and how they are suited to their project’s needs. It’s also helpful to consider site-specific factors like soil composition, water table levels, and the load requirements of the structure. Consulting with a professional can provide clarity on the most appropriate foundation type and ensure the installation process aligns with the property's long-term stability and safety.

Common Deep Foundation Installation Jobs
Deep foundation installation supports structures by providing a stable base in challenging soil conditions.
Pile driving services install long, load-bearing piles to strengthen building foundations.
Pier and pile systems are used to stabilize existing structures or prepare new construction sites.
Helical piles offer quick, minimally invasive solutions for foundation reinforcement.
Underpinning services improve the stability of aging or settling foundations.
Foundation reinforcement helps prevent shifting, cracking, and other structural issues.
Deep Foundation Installation Questions
What is deep foundation installation? It involves placing strong support structures beneath a building to ensure stability, especially on challenging soil conditions.
What types of projects require deep foundations? Foundations are often needed for new home construction, additions, or structures built on uneven or unstable ground.
How does deep foundation installation benefit property owners? It provides long-term stability and reduces the risk of settling or shifting in the building.
What soil conditions are suitable for deep foundations? Deep foundations work well in areas with loose, clay, or variable soil types where shallow support is insufficient.
